> That was fixed in MonoTouch 4.2.2 [1] and recent 4.9.x alphas. Of 
> course the monotouch.dll required to support the iOS5 API will be 
> larger (than before) so not linking will result in even larger 
> applications (i.e. linking will become even more important). 
> 
> Another common reason for large applications on device is using FAT 
> binaries (i.e. armv6 + armv7).

> >>>> We've very recently discovered that there are a few issues you can 
> >>>> easily run into when deploying applications built with the iOS5 sdk on 
> >>>> iOS4 devices (in particular it will crash immediately upon startup). 
> >>>> If you run into any such issues, just ask and attach the corresponding 
> >>>> crash log, and I can explain how to work around it (in some cases 
> >>>> we'll always link with iOS5 frameworks, which will cause the 
> >>>> application to fail to load on older devices. The fix is to build 
> >>>> against the iOS4 sdk and add the required frameworks manually using 
> >>>> -weak_framework in mtouch' extra arguments).

> >>>> > Yes, this should be possible to do. What you'll need to do is check 
> >>>> > the iOS 
> >>>> > version (MonoTouch.UIKit.UIDevice.CurrentDevice.SystemVersion) and 
> >>>> > depending 
> >>>> > on the value, take different code paths in your app providing 
> >>>> > differentfeatures depending on the underlying iOS version.
